Yes! Been struggling for a couple of months and it’s just getting worse. At first she was fighting bedtime but we capped the nap to 30 minutes (or not at all) or brought it earlier in the day which sorted the issue. Now she’s fighting naps and will only fall asleep in the pram being rocked at nap and bedtime. She rarely naps at all and copes fine all day. This week she now keeps having split nights or even starting the day at 3am - I got three hours sleep last night 🤦🏼♀️ Starting to wonder if her final couple of teeth are coming through

What really shocks me is how easily she will fall asleep pretty much on her own at nursery and sleep for 1.5-3h there and when she’s home me and my husband have to jump through hoops to get her to sleep!
